Shares of NASDAQ:SNDK opened at $1,615.00 on Thursday. Sandisk Corporation has a 1 year low of $40.10 and a 1 year high of $2,354.39. The company has a market cap of $239.17 billion, a P/E ratio of 56.13 and a beta of 4.74. The stock’s fifty day moving average price is $1,748.98 and its 200-day moving average price is $1,032.16.
Sandisk (NASDAQ:SNDK –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, April 30th. The data storage provider reported $23.41 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$14.17 by $9.24. Sandisk had a return on equity of 44.06% and a net margin of 34.19%.The company had revenue of $5.95 billion during the quarter.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business posted ($0.30) earnings per share. Sandisk’s quarterly revenue was up 251.0% compared to the same quarter last year. Sandisk has set its Q4 2026 guidance at 30.000-33.000 EPS. On average, sell-side analysts anticipate that Sandisk Corporation will post 64.95 earnings per share for the current year.

About Sandisk
SanDisk Corporation offers flash storage solutions. The Company designs, develops and manufactures data storage solutions in a range of form factors using flash memory, controller, firmware and software technologies. The Company operates through flash memory storage products segment. Its solutions include a range of solid state drives (SSD), embedded products, removable cards, universal serial bus (USB), drives, wireless media drives, digital media players, and wafers and components. It offers SSDs for client computing applications, which encompass desktop computers, notebook computers, tablets and other computing devices.
